説明
現在のソリューションのターゲット デバイス、デバイス ファミリ、またはボードを設定します。このコマンドは、アクティブ ソリューションのコンテキストでのみ実行可能です。
ヒント: プロジェクトの各ソリューションに、異なるデバイスまたはデバイス ファミリを指定できます。
構文
set_part <device_specification>
-
<device_specification>
: Vitis HLS での合成およびインプリメンテーションのターゲット デバイスを設定するデバイス仕様を指定します。 - デバイス仕様には、
<device>
、<package>
、および<speed_grade>
情報が含まれます。 -
<device_family>
を指定すると、そのデバイス ファミリのデフォルトのデバイスが使用されます。
オプション
-
-board
- ボードを指定することによりそのボード上のパーツを指定します。
例
次の例に示すようにデバイス ファミリ名を指定すると、Vitis HLS に含まれる FPGA ライブラリを現在のソリューションに追加できます。この場合、Vitis HLS の FPGA ライブラリで Virtex 7 デバイス ファミリに対して指定されているデフォルトのデバイス、パッケージおよびスピード グレードが使用されます。
set_part virtex7
Vitis HLS に含まれる FPGA ライブラリでは、特定のデバイスをパッケージおよびスピード グレード情報と共に指定することもできます。
set_part xc6vlx240tff1156-1
ボードを定義することによりパーツを指定します。
set_part -board u200